Human face has been a hot research point in computer vision, pattern recognitionand image/video processing field and it is a credible source for biometric. In videomonitoring systems, face images acquired by camera are usually in low-resoltion,blurring and difficult to recognize, which sets a barrier for police department to crackdown criminal cases. Face hallucination is used to improve the resolution of faceimages and make recognition easy and fast.Our research is to recover a high-resolution face image from a low-resolution one.For this purpose, it is required to draw some important characteristics like contours anddetails. Our method is toughly divived into two parts: global reconstruction and localdetail compensation.Our innovation points are:1) In the global reconstruction phase, we build two eigenface dictionaries in twodifferent scales using sample face images. In low-resolution scale, coeffieentsvector is obtained with the help of Matching Pursuit algorithm.2) In the local detail compensation phase, we divide all face images includedglobal reconstruction result, high-resolution sample face images and lapacianpryriam image generated by them into patches.We untilize Markov RandomField to form a detail face image to compensate the high-frequencycomponents in the global face. The simplified pairwise compatitiblityfunctions accelerate the energy convergence and reduce computation load.A series of experiments from both subjective and objective aspects demonstratesthat our method is able to achieve satisfactory results. And we develop a PC softwarewhich implemented our method and make it possible for practical use.
